Full Job Description
We are seeking a highly skilled Deputy Modeling & Simulation Lead to support a cutting-edge Space-Based Interceptor (SBI) program in Huntsville, Alabama.

The ideal candidate will bring strong technical expertise in M&S development, integration, and analysis, along with proven experience briefing senior leaders, collaborating across diverse stakeholder groups, and supporting ground test activities. This role will serve as a key contributor to M&S strategy and execution, ensuring analytic rigor and alignment with program objectives.

Responsibilities
  • Support the M&S Lead in planning, developing, executing, and maintaining modeling and simulation capabilities for the SBI program.
  • Develop, refine, and validate models supporting system performance, threat analysis, engagement timelines, and operational concepts.
  • Coordinate with engineering, system design, flight software, test, and mission analysis teams to ensure consistency between models and program technical baselines.
  • Prepare and deliver clear, concise, and technically accurate briefings to senior leadership, government customers, and internal stakeholders.
  • Engage with external partners, contractors, and government stakeholders to communicate M&S requirements, integration needs, and results.
  • Support ground test design, execution, data collection, and analysis; incorporate results into M&S updates and performance assessments.
  • Ensure M&S artifacts meet program standards, configuration control requirements, and documentation expectations.
  • Assist in identifying risks, gaps, and opportunities for M&S tool enhancement to support system development and decision-making.
  • Provide mentorship and technical guidance to junior team members.


Qualifications:

Required Education and Experience:
  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Physics, Applied Mathematics, Computer Science, or a related technical field; advanced degree preferred.
  • 14 years of experience in modeling and simulation within aerospace, missile defense, space systems, or similar domains.
  • Demonstrated experience supporting system development programs, including test integration or ground test activities.
  • Strong communication skills and experience briefing complex technical content to senior leaders and stakeholders.
  • Ability to work collaboratively in a fast-paced, highly technical environment.


Required Clearance:
  • Active Secret Clearance, Top Secret preferred; US Citizenship required.


Preferred Qualifications
  • Experience with missile defense systems, interceptor design, or kill vehicle performance modeling.
  • Background in digital engineering or model-based systems engineering (MBSE).
  • Experience with verification & validation processes for physics-based models.
  • Familiarity with ground or flight test data analysis.
  • Proficiency with M&S tools such as MATLAB, Simulink, Python-based frameworks, C++, or government/industry-standard modeling environments.
